cabal-version: 1.22 name: poker-base version: description: This package provides datatypes and support for poker computation in Haskell. . == Usage . >>> import Poker >>> Just h = mkHole (Card Ace Club) (Card Two Diamond) >>> holeToShortTxt h "Ac2d" . Please see the README on GitHub at for an overview. category: Poker synopsis: A library for core poker types homepage: bug-reports: author: Santiago Weight maintainer: copyright: 2021 Santiago Weight license: BSD3 license-file: LICENSE build-type: Simple tested-with: GHC == 8.6.5 || == 8.8.4 || == 8.10.7 || == 9.0.1 extra-doc-files: source-repository head type: git location: library exposed-modules: Poker Poker.Range Poker.Amount Poker.Cards Poker.Game other-modules: Poker.Utils hs-source-dirs: src ghc-options: -Wall -Wcompat -Wincomplete-record-updates -Wincomplete-uni-patterns -Wredundant-constraints -funbox-strict-fields build-depends: base >= 4.11 && <5, text >= 0.11 && <1.3, containers >= 0.5 && <0.7, prettyprinter >= 1.6 && < 1.8, safe-money >= 0.9 && < 0.10, QuickCheck >= 2.12 && < 2.15, generic-arbitrary >= 0.1 && < 0.3 default-language: Haskell2010 default-extensions: ConstraintKinds DataKinds DeriveDataTypeable DeriveFunctor DeriveGeneric DeriveTraversable EmptyCase FlexibleContexts FlexibleInstances GADTs GeneralizedNewtypeDeriving InstanceSigs LambdaCase MultiParamTypeClasses PolyKinds RankNTypes ScopedTypeVariables StandaloneDeriving TypeApplications TypeOperators TypeFamilies TemplateHaskell ViewPatterns test-suite all-tests type: exitcode-stdio-1.0 main-is: Driver.hs other-modules: Test.Poker.Cards Test.Poker.Game Test.Poker.Range hs-source-dirs: test ghc-options: -Wall -Wcompat -Wincomplete-record-updates -Wincomplete-uni-patterns -Wredundant-constraints -funbox-strict-fields -threaded -rtsopts -with-rtsopts=-N -Wall build-depends: base >= 4.11 && <5, poker-base, text >= 0.11 && <1.3, prettyprinter >= 1.6 && < 1.8, containers >= 0.5 && <0.7, QuickCheck >= 2.13.2 && < 2.15, extra >= 1.6.18 && < 1.8, hspec >= 2.7.1 && < 2.9, tasty >= 1.2.3 && < 1.5, tasty-discover, tasty-hspec >= 1.1 && < 1.3, tasty-quickcheck >= 0.10.1 && < 0.11 build-tool-depends: tasty-discover:tasty-discover default-language: Haskell2010 default-extensions: ConstraintKinds DataKinds DeriveDataTypeable DeriveFunctor DeriveGeneric DeriveTraversable EmptyCase FlexibleContexts FlexibleInstances GADTs GeneralizedNewtypeDeriving InstanceSigs LambdaCase MultiParamTypeClasses PolyKinds RankNTypes ScopedTypeVariables StandaloneDeriving TypeApplications TypeOperators TypeFamilies TemplateHaskell